/** * This file represents an example of the code that themes would use to register * the required plugins. * * It is expected that theme authors would copy and paste this code into their * functions.php file, and amend to suit. * * @package TGM-Plugin-Activation * @subpackage Example * @version 2.3.6 * @author Thomas Griffin * @author Gary Jones * @copyright Copyright (c) 2012, Thomas Griffin * @license http://opensource.org/licenses/gpl-2.0.php GPL v2 or later * @link https://github.com/thomasgriffin/TGM-Plugin-Activation */ /** * Include the TGM_Plugin_Activation class. */ require_once dirname( __FILE__ ) . '/class-tgm-plugin-activation.php'; add_action( 'tgmpa_register', 'my_theme_register_required_plugins' ); /** * Register the required plugins for this theme. * * In this example, we register two plugins - one included with the TGMPA library * and one from the .org repo. * * The variable passed to tgmpa_register_plugins() should be an array of plugin * arrays. * * This function is hooked into tgmpa_init, which is fired within the * TGM_Plugin_Activation class constructor. */ function my_theme_register_required_plugins() { /** * Array of plugin arrays. Required keys are name and slug. * If the source is NOT from the .org repo, then source is also required. */ $plugins = array( // This is an example of how to include a plugin pre-packaged with a theme array( 'name' => 'Contact Form 7', // The plugin name 'slug' => 'contact-form-7', // The plugin slug (typically the folder name) 'source' => get_stylesheet_directory() . '/includes/plugins/contact-form-7.zip', // The plugin source 'required' => true, // If false, the plugin is only 'recommended' instead of required 'version' => '', // E.g. 1.0.0. If set, the active plugin must be this version or higher, otherwise a notice is presented 'force_activation' => false, // If true, plugin is activated upon theme activation and cannot be deactivated until theme switch 'force_deactivation' => false, // If true, plugin is deactivated upon theme switch, useful for theme-specific plugins 'external_url' => '', // If set, overrides default API URL and points to an external URL ), array( 'name' => 'Cherry Plugin', // The plugin name. 'slug' => 'cherry-plugin', // The plugin slug (typically the folder name). 'source' => PARENT_DIR . '/includes/plugins/cherry-plugin.zip', // The plugin source. 'required' => true, // If false, the plugin is only 'recommended' instead of required. 'version' => '1.1', // E.g. 1.0.0. If set, the active plugin must be this version or higher, otherwise a notice is presented. 'force_activation' => true, // If true, plugin is activated upon theme activation and cannot be deactivated until theme switch. 'force_deactivation' => false, // If true, plugin is deactivated upon theme switch, useful for theme-specific plugins. 'external_url' => '', // If set, overrides default API URL and points to an external URL. ) ); /** * Array of configuration settings. Amend each line as needed. * If you want the default strings to be available under your own theme domain, * leave the strings uncommented. * Some of the strings are added into a sprintf, so see the comments at the * end of each line for what each argument will be. */ $config = array( 'domain' => CURRENT_THEME, // Text domain - likely want to be the same as your theme. 'default_path' => '', // Default absolute path to pre-packaged plugins 'parent_menu_slug' => 'themes.php', // Default parent menu slug 'parent_url_slug' => 'themes.php', // Default parent URL slug 'menu' => 'install-required-plugins', // Menu slug 'has_notices' => true, // Show admin notices or not 'is_automatic' => true, // Automatically activate plugins after installation or not 'message' => '', // Message to output right before the plugins table 'strings' => array( 'page_title' => theme_locals("page_title"), 'menu_title' => theme_locals("menu_title"), 'installing' => theme_locals("installing"), // %1$s = plugin name 'oops' => theme_locals("oops_2"), 'notice_can_install_required' => _n_noop( theme_locals("notice_can_install_required"), theme_locals("notice_can_install_required_2") ), // %1$s = plugin name(s) 'notice_can_install_recommended' => _n_noop( theme_locals("notice_can_install_recommended"), theme_locals("notice_can_install_recommended_2") ), // %1$s = plugin name(s) 'notice_cannot_install' => _n_noop( theme_locals("notice_cannot_install"), theme_locals("notice_cannot_install_2") ), // %1$s = plugin name(s) 'notice_can_activate_required' => _n_noop( theme_locals("notice_can_activate_required"), theme_locals("notice_can_activate_required_2") ), // %1$s = plugin name(s) 'notice_can_activate_recommended' => _n_noop( theme_locals("notice_can_activate_recommended"), theme_locals("notice_can_activate_recommended_2") ), // %1$s = plugin name(s) 'notice_cannot_activate' => _n_noop( theme_locals("notice_cannot_activate"), theme_locals("notice_cannot_activate_2") ), // %1$s = plugin name(s) 'notice_ask_to_update' => _n_noop( theme_locals("notice_ask_to_update"), theme_locals("notice_ask_to_update_2") ), // %1$s = plugin name(s) 'notice_cannot_update' => _n_noop( theme_locals("notice_cannot_update"), theme_locals("notice_cannot_update_2") ), // %1$s = plugin name(s) 'install_link' => _n_noop( theme_locals("install_link"), theme_locals("install_link_2") ), 'activate_link' => _n_noop( theme_locals("activate_link"), theme_locals("activate_link_2") ), 'return' => theme_locals("return"), 'plugin_activated' => theme_locals("plugin_activated"), 'complete' => theme_locals("complete"), // %1$s = dashboard link 'nag_type' => theme_locals("updated") // Determines admin notice type - can only be 'updated' or 'error' ) ); tgmpa( $plugins, $config ); } Betti Casino Review 2026 A Comprehensive Guide to Online Gaming -1909356292

Betti Casino Review 2026 A Comprehensive Guide to Online Gaming -1909356292

Betti Casino Review 2026: Your Ultimate Guide to the Online Gaming Experience

As online gaming continues to flourish in the digital era, various platforms strive to stand out in a crowded market. One such platform is Betti Casino Review 2026 www.betti.us.com/, an online casino that has garnered attention for its extensive game selection, appealing bonuses, and user-friendly interface. In this comprehensive review, we delve into the various aspects of Betti Casino to provide you with an insightful overview of what this platform offers in 2026.

Overview of Betti Casino

Betti Casino was established with the primary goal of providing players with a memorable online gaming experience. The platform showcases a dazzling array of games, including slots, table games, and live dealer options, catering to diverse preferences and playstyles. Quick registration, numerous payment options, and customer satisfaction are significant pillars supporting Betti Casino's reputation in the online gaming community.

Game Selection

At the heart of any online casino’s appeal is its game library, and Betti Casino does not disappoint. The platform hosts a wide range of games from some of the industry’s most reputable software developers. Here’s a closer look at the types of games you can expect to find:

Slots

Betti Casino has a remarkable collection of video slots, featuring everything from classic three-reel games to modern video slots packed with exciting features like bonus rounds, free spins, and progressive jackpots. Players can enjoy popular titles such as 'Starburst', 'Gonzo’s Quest', and the latest releases that keep popping up to enhance the gaming experience.

Table Games

If you prefer traditional casino games, Betti Casino offers a solid selection of table games, including classic variations of Blackjack, Roulette, Baccarat, and Poker. The intuitive user interface allows players to navigate effortlessly through the available options, ensuring a seamless gaming experience.

Live Dealer Games

For those seeking an authentic casino experience from the comfort of their homes, Betti Casino features live dealer games. Players can interact with professional dealers in real-time, adding an engaging social element to games like Live Blackjack, Live Roulette, and Live Baccarat.

Bonuses and Promotions

Attracting new players and retaining existing ones is crucial for any online casino, and Betti Casino has crafted an impressive array of bonuses and promotions. Here are some noteworthy offers:

Welcome Bonus

New players are greeted with a lucrative welcome bonus that often includes match deposits and free spins, allowing them to dive into the gaming experience and explore different games without spending too much of their own money. The specifics of the welcome bonus can vary, so players should check the promotions page for the latest details.

Ongoing Promotions

To keep the excitement alive, Betti Casino provides a variety of ongoing promotions, such as cashback offers, reload bonuses, and periodic tournaments. Players are encouraged to participate regularly to maximize their gaming experience and potentially enhance their bankroll.

Loyalty Program

Betti Casino Review 2026 A Comprehensive Guide to Online Gaming -1909356292

Betti Casino values its regular players and rewards their loyalty through a tiered loyalty program. As players wager more, they can climb the ranks, unlocking exclusive rewards such as higher withdrawal limits, personalized customer support, and special bonuses tailored to their gameplay preferences.

Payment Methods

Convenience and security are integral when it comes to online transactions, and Betti Casino offers a wide range of payment methods to cater to players from different regions. Players can typically use options like credit and debit cards, e-wallets, and bank transfers. The platform prioritizes the security of transactions by employing encryption technology to protect users’ financial information.

Customer Support

Efficient customer support is essential to address players' queries and concerns. Betti Casino provides several support channels, including live chat, email, and an extensive FAQ section. The customer support team is trained to assist players promptly in various matters, ensuring that any issues encountered during gaming are resolved efficiently.

User Experience and Mobile Gaming

Betti Casino prides itself on offering a user-friendly platform. The website is designed for easy navigation, enabling players to find their favorite games effortlessly. In addition, with a growing number of players gaming on the go, Betti Casino has optimized its platform for mobile use. Whether you are using a smartphone or tablet, the mobile site provides a seamless experience that mirrors the desktop version.

Conclusion: Is Betti Casino Worth Your Time in 2026?

After a thorough review of Betti Casino, it is clear that this online gaming platform has made significant strides to establish itself as a leading choice for players in 2026. With a fantastic game selection, generous bonuses, reliable payment methods, and dedicated customer support, Betti Casino has much to offer to both newcomers and seasoned players alike.

As online gaming continues to evolve, Betti Casino remains committed to enhancing its offerings and ensuring player satisfaction. Whether you’re in the mood for exciting slot games, classic table games, or the thrill of live dealer options, Betti Casino is definitely worth considering.